The invention discloses ultrahigh viaduct erection hoisting equipment for traffic construction and a hoisting method thereof. The ultrahigh viaduct erection hoisting equipment comprises a bottom plate and a sponge block, a tripod is arranged above the left side of the bottom plate, and a telescopic frame is installed on the right side of the bottom plate. A first air cylinder is installed on the inner side of the upper end of the tripod, and a rotating shaft is arranged at the top end of the tripod. A transverse rod is arranged on the inner side of the rotating shaft, and a winding motor is installed at the left end of the transverse rod. A second air cylinder is arranged above the telescopic frame, a supporting rod is arranged above the second air cylinder, a supporting frame is installed above the supporting rod, a lifting hook is arranged at the right end of the supporting rod, and a notch is formed in the inner side of the supporting frame. A connecting block is arranged on the inner side of the notch, and the sponge block is arranged above the connecting block. According to the ultrahigh viaduct erection hoisting equipment for traffic construction, the sponge block is arranged and has good adsorption capacity, a lubricating agent can be fully absorbed, and a rotating rod can be lubricated in time.
